Jarrolds Valley Subdivision
Railway line in West Virginia
The Jarrolds Valley Subdivision is a railroad line owned by CSX Transportation in the U.S. state of West Virginia. It was formerly part of the CSX Huntington East Division.[1] It became part of the CSX Florence Division on June 20, 2016. The line runs from Whitesville, West Virginia, to Clear Creek, West Virginia, for a total of 15.3 miles (24.6 km). At its south end it continues north from the Big Coal Subdivision and at its north end the track comes to an end.[2]
